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Pleasant View Park (Franklin, WI)
Pleasant View Park is situated in Franklin, a southern suburb of Milwaukee, Wisconsin. The park is easily accessible via major roadways like Highway 100 (Mayfair Road) and Loomis Road, which connect to I-94/I-43 and I-94 West. For those flying in, Milwaukee Mitchell International Airport (MKE) is approximately a 15-20 minute drive north. Parking is generally available directly within the park, with designated lots serving different areas, though it can fill up on busy summer weekends or during special events. Public transit options are limited in this suburban setting, making car or rideshare the most common methods of arrival. Arriving earlier in the day, especially on weekends or during warmer months, is recommended to secure convenient parking and avoid potential queues.

Weather & Seasons at Pleasant View Park
- Winter: Expect cold temperatures with averages often in the teens and twenties Fahrenheit. Visitors should dress in warm layers, including hats, gloves, and waterproof outerwear. The park is less crowded, offering a peaceful, snowy landscape for brisk walks, though amenities might be limited. Clear paths are maintained when possible, but snow accumulation can affect trail accessibility.
- Spring & early summer: Temperatures gradually warm from the forties to the seventies Fahrenheit. Light to medium layers are advisable, with rain gear recommended as showers are common. This is an ideal time to visit as the park’s greenery returns, flowers bloom, and outdoor activities become increasingly pleasant before the peak summer heat.
- Mid-summer: Expect warm to hot conditions, with daytime highs frequently in the eighties and nineties Fahrenheit, often with high humidity. Light, breathable clothing is essential. Stay hydrated by bringing plenty of water, and utilize shaded areas and park shelters during the hottest parts of the day. Early mornings and late evenings offer the most comfortable temperatures for active pursuits.
- Fall season: Temperatures cool into the fifties and sixties Fahrenheit, providing crisp, comfortable weather. Layers are key, with a light jacket or sweater being comfortable for daytime activities. The park’s foliage displays vibrant colors, making it a beautiful time for walking and enjoying the outdoors before the winter chill sets in.
- Rain & snow: Rain is frequent throughout spring and fall, and can occur during summer. Snow is common in winter months. Waterproof footwear and outerwear are recommended year-round for unexpected weather. During heavy rain or snow, indoor alternatives like the nearby library or local eateries become more appealing options.
